Understanding Deep Learning and AI

Before diving into investment strategies, it's essential to have a fundamental understanding of deep learning and how it powers AI products. Deep learning is a branch of machine learning that uses artificial neural networks with multiple layers to process data. These networks can learn and make decisions by analyzing vast amounts of data, enabling them to perform complex tasks such as image recognition, natural language processing, and autonomous driving.

Deep learning models can be applied to a wide range of industries, from healthcare and finance to entertainment and logistics. The core of these applications lies in the ability of deep learning systems to extract patterns and insights from data. AI products powered by deep learning have become integral in areas like:

  • Voice recognition (e.g., Apple's Siri, Amazon's Alexa)
  • Recommendation systems (e.g., Netflix, YouTube)
  • Autonomous vehicles (e.g., Tesla)
  • Medical diagnostics (e.g., AI-powered radiology tools)

As the demand for AI solutions continues to grow, the market for AI-powered products and services has expanded dramatically. This provides investors with opportunities to generate passive income by putting capital into deep learning-based products or services.

1. Investing in AI Startups and Companies Developing Deep Learning Solutions

One of the most straightforward ways to generate passive income from deep learning products is by investing in AI startups or established companies that develop deep learning solutions. These companies are at the forefront of AI technology, and many of them offer investment opportunities for individuals.

How to Get Started

  • Venture Capital and Angel Investing: If you have significant capital and are willing to take on higher risk, you can consider becoming an angel investor or participating in venture capital funding rounds for AI startups. Many startups are focused on applying deep learning in various sectors like healthcare, fintech, logistics, and entertainment. By investing early in these startups, you have the potential to earn substantial returns as these companies grow and become profitable.
  • Public Companies in the AI Space: For those who prefer a more passive and lower-risk investment approach, buying shares in publicly traded companies that specialize in AI and deep learning is an option. Major tech giants like Google (Alphabet) , Microsoft , and NVIDIA have made significant strides in AI and deep learning. Their products, such as cloud-based AI platforms, autonomous driving systems, and AI-powered hardware, provide consistent revenue streams for these companies.

Why This Works

Investing in companies that develop AI-powered deep learning products offers the potential for long-term gains as these companies continue to innovate. As demand for AI solutions increases across various industries, these companies are likely to see a growth in revenue and market share. By owning shares in such companies, investors can benefit from the appreciation of stock prices over time.

Additionally, many publicly traded companies also pay dividends, which can provide investors with a steady stream of passive income.

2. Investing in AI-Powered SaaS (Software as a Service) Products

SaaS products that leverage deep learning have become increasingly popular due to their ability to provide businesses and consumers with valuable AI-driven solutions. SaaS companies typically operate on a subscription-based model, which can generate a reliable and recurring income stream for investors.

Examples of AI-Powered SaaS Products

  • AI-Powered Customer Support Chatbots: Many companies use deep learning-based chatbots to improve customer service, reduce operational costs, and provide faster response times to customers. These chatbots can be integrated into websites or applications, making them a valuable tool for businesses looking to improve customer experiences.
  • AI-Based Analytics Platforms: Deep learning algorithms are often used to power data analytics platforms that help businesses make better decisions. These platforms can offer services like predictive analytics, customer segmentation, and personalized recommendations, which are essential in industries like e-commerce, marketing, and finance.
  • AI for Content Creation: AI-driven content generation tools are being used by marketers, bloggers, and content creators to automate the process of writing articles, social media posts, and product descriptions. These tools use natural language processing and deep learning models to generate human-like text based on prompts provided by users.

How to Get Involved

To invest in AI-powered SaaS products, you can either:

  • Buy Stocks in SaaS Companies: Many AI-focused SaaS companies are publicly traded. By purchasing shares of these companies, you can receive a portion of the company's profits in the form of dividends or stock price appreciation.
  • Invest in SaaS Startups: If you're looking for higher returns and are willing to take on more risk, investing in early-stage SaaS startups can be a profitable strategy. These startups may provide equity or convertible debt in exchange for funding, which can potentially yield significant returns if the company grows and gets acquired or goes public.

Why This Works

AI-powered SaaS products are highly scalable, meaning that once they are developed, they can serve a large number of customers with minimal incremental costs. This makes them ideal for generating passive income. The subscription-based model also ensures consistent and predictable revenue streams for these companies, which can translate into stable returns for investors.

3. Investing in AI-Powered Digital Products and Marketplaces

Deep learning technologies have enabled the creation of digital products that can be sold on marketplaces. These digital products include pre-trained models, APIs, and even AI-driven applications. Investing in such products can offer a passive income stream through royalties, licensing fees, or subscription models.

Examples of AI-Powered Digital Products

  • Pre-Trained Deep Learning Models: AI developers can create pre-trained deep learning models for tasks like image classification, object detection, and sentiment analysis. These models can be sold on platforms like Hugging Face , TensorFlow Hub , and AWS Marketplace. Investors can earn passive income by purchasing and licensing these models to other businesses or developers.
  • AI-Driven APIs: Many companies offer AI-powered APIs that can be integrated into websites or applications. For example, an image recognition API or a text-to-speech API powered by deep learning can be monetized on a pay-per-use basis. Investors can earn passive income by purchasing shares or licenses in companies that offer these APIs.
  • AI-Based Art and Content Creation Platforms: Platforms like Artbreeder and RunwayML enable users to generate AI-powered artwork, music, and other content using deep learning algorithms. Investors can participate in these platforms by purchasing or licensing the AI models used for content creation.

Why This Works

Digital products powered by deep learning can be sold multiple times with minimal ongoing effort. Once an AI model or API is developed and listed on a marketplace, it can continue to generate income through purchases, subscriptions, or licensing deals without significant ongoing work from the creator.

Investing in companies that develop these digital products can provide passive income opportunities through royalties, licensing fees, and sales revenue shares.

4. Investing in AI-Powered Hardware and Devices

Deep learning applications often require specialized hardware, such as GPUs (Graphics Processing Units) or custom-designed chips, to run efficiently. Companies like NVIDIA , Intel , and AMD have developed hardware designed specifically for AI and deep learning applications. As AI technologies become more integrated into consumer and industrial products, the demand for AI-powered hardware will continue to grow.

Examples of AI-Powered Hardware Products

  • AI-Powered Smart Devices: Consumer products such as smart speakers, smart cameras, and wearables increasingly rely on AI and deep learning for features like voice recognition, facial recognition, and predictive analytics.
  • AI-Based Robotics: Robots powered by deep learning algorithms are used in industries such as manufacturing, logistics, and healthcare. These robots can perform tasks like assembly, inspection, and medical diagnostics autonomously, which opens up investment opportunities in companies that develop AI-powered robots.
  • Autonomous Vehicles: Companies like Tesla are heavily investing in AI-powered hardware to enable autonomous driving. These vehicles rely on deep learning algorithms to interpret sensor data and make driving decisions.

How to Invest

You can invest in AI-powered hardware by purchasing stocks of companies that manufacture the required chips, processors, and other hardware components. For example, NVIDIA and Intel are leaders in the development of AI hardware, and their products are critical to the success of AI applications across industries. By investing in these companies, you can capitalize on the growing demand for AI-powered devices and technologies.

Why This Works

AI-powered hardware is an essential component of many AI-driven products. As industries increasingly adopt AI technologies, the demand for specialized hardware is expected to grow. By investing in companies that produce these hardware components, investors can benefit from long-term growth and a steady stream of passive income.
